The document summarizes planning strategies for Dresden, Germany. It discusses the city's inner city planning strategy from 2008, which prioritizes inner development and defines goals and standards of quality. It also discusses the transport development plan from 2025, which aims to develop sustainable mobility while addressing challenges related to quality of life, societal changes, and economic balance. The strategies establish guiding principles for inner city development, land use, mobility, and quality of urban spaces to guide Dresden's planning into the future.
